Occurs to me that even if a shill wins, this just opens the door for the seller to send a "second chance offer" to the next highest bidder, saying that there was a problem with the winner's payment, etc... This has happened to me a couple of times when I bid more than I knew an item would ordinarily bring, because I really wanted the item.
Perhaps if Ebay did away with the second chance offer it would reduce the amount of dishonest selling?
